Norton Online Backup: constantly problems with wrong available backup space

I have constantly problems with NOB, which are making this service nearly unusable:

 

Problem 1: I have 25GB subscription, but it shows me, that I have 40 GB.

 I had some 5GB subscription, which expired in the past. Tech support was NOT ABLE to remove those from my available storage space. This is really not very usefull to see always more storage space, than you actually are subscribed for.

 

Problem 2 is much more serious: There seems to be really a bug with storage calculation. I have approx 10GB of data to backup, so my 25GB subscription should be more than enough. Today, NOB told me, that I have no longer any storage space. I've purged EVERY file and REMOVE my pc, but it still shows me, that I use 20.95 GB of 40.00 GB which is completely wrong.

 

I currently use 0.00 GB of 25.00 GB !

 

I already had this problem a few weeks ago. I have contacted online support and it used me hours, yes hours, until the tech support guys understood the problem I have! It then dured again more than a week until the engineering could solve this problem and I got my "lost" storage space back.

 

Now, again the same problem and I really have no intention to talk again hours to first level tech support to try to explain them this simple but very serious issue.

 

Sorry, but NOB is nearly unusable this way. My idea was to have a secure online storage for important data and not to spend hours with tech support every few weeks.

Renato,


renatorichina wrote:

in NOBU, it shows me, that I have 40GB space, but in fact, I only have a subscription for 25GB. I had 3x 5GB older subscription, which expired monthes ago. But they are also still counted but can not be used in NOBU. So I really only would have 25GB when I subscribe for 25GB and not a theoretical 40GB, which is wrong. Hope you understood now :)


The space NOBU shows you is the space you have available. Right now after an older subscription expires you continue to keep the space. You can back up 40 GB of data if it says 40 GB of space available. This may change in the future but right now just consider it a freebie.
